Build packages for mbedtls on 2024-12-13-14-04 (#10944)

* mbedtls => 3.6.2

Signed-off-by: Satadru Pramanik <satadru@gmail.com>

* Add built packages for linux/386 to mbedtls

* Add built packages for linux/amd64 to mbedtls

* Add built packages for linux/arm/v7 to mbedtls

* Try to trigger Unit Test workflow from Build workflow again.

Signed-off-by: Satadru Pramanik <satadru@gmail.com>

* Reduce workflow timestamp granularity.

Signed-off-by: Satadru Pramanik <satadru@gmail.com>

* Adjust PR creation wording.

Signed-off-by: Satadru Pramanik <satadru@gmail.com>

* suggested changes

Signed-off-by: Satadru Pramanik <satadru@gmail.com>

---------

Signed-off-by: Satadru Pramanik <satadru@gmail.com>
Co-authored-by: Satadru Pramanik <satadru@gmail.com>
Co-authored-by: satmandu <satmandu@users.noreply.github.com>
This commit is contained in:
github-actions[bot]
2024-12-13 13:42:19 -06:00
committed by GitHub
parent d1871f255a
commit e76e09a4ff
5 changed files with 29 additions and 16 deletions

View File

@@ -34,7 +34,7 @@ jobs:
- name: Set workflow & branch variables
id: set-variables
run: |
export TIMESTAMP="$(date -u +%F-%H-%M)"
export TIMESTAMP="$(date -u +%F-%H%Z)"
echo "TIMESTAMP=${TIMESTAMP}" >> $GITHUB_OUTPUT
generate:
strategy:
@@ -286,6 +286,16 @@ jobs:
echo "- ${file}" >> /tmp/pr.txt
done
cat /tmp/pr.txt
export PR_NUMBER=$(gh pr create --title "Automatic PR to build packages for ${{ github.ref_name }} on ${{ needs.setup.outputs.output1 }}" -F /tmp/pr.txt | rev | cut -d"/" -f1 | rev)
export PR_NUMBER=$(gh pr create --title "Automated Package Build: ${{ github.ref_name }} branch started at ${{ needs.setup.outputs.output1 }}" -F /tmp/pr.txt | rev | cut -d"/" -f1 | rev)
echo "PR_NUMBER is ${PR_NUMBER}"
echo "PR_NUMBER=${PR_NUMBER}" >> $GITHUB_ENV
- name: Trigger Unit Test Workflow
uses: actions/github-script@v6
with:
script: |
github.rest.actions.createWorkflowDispatch({
owner: context.repo.owner,
repo: context.repo.repo,
workflow_id: 'Unit-Test.yml',
ref: '${{ github.ref_name }}'
})

View File

@@ -152,6 +152,7 @@
/usr/local/include/psa/build_info.h
/usr/local/include/psa/crypto.h
/usr/local/include/psa/crypto_adjust_auto_enabled.h
/usr/local/include/psa/crypto_adjust_config_dependencies.h
/usr/local/include/psa/crypto_adjust_config_key_pair_types.h
/usr/local/include/psa/crypto_adjust_config_synonyms.h
/usr/local/include/psa/crypto_builtin_composites.h
@@ -179,14 +180,14 @@
/usr/local/lib/libmbedcrypto.a
/usr/local/lib/libmbedcrypto.so
/usr/local/lib/libmbedcrypto.so.16
/usr/local/lib/libmbedcrypto.so.3.6.0
/usr/local/lib/libmbedcrypto.so.3.6.2
/usr/local/lib/libmbedtls.a
/usr/local/lib/libmbedtls.so
/usr/local/lib/libmbedtls.so.21
/usr/local/lib/libmbedtls.so.3.6.0
/usr/local/lib/libmbedtls.so.3.6.2
/usr/local/lib/libmbedx509.a
/usr/local/lib/libmbedx509.so
/usr/local/lib/libmbedx509.so.3.6.0
/usr/local/lib/libmbedx509.so.3.6.2
/usr/local/lib/libmbedx509.so.7
/usr/local/lib/libp256m.a
/usr/local/lib/pkgconfig/mbedcrypto.pc

View File

@@ -152,6 +152,7 @@
/usr/local/include/psa/build_info.h
/usr/local/include/psa/crypto.h
/usr/local/include/psa/crypto_adjust_auto_enabled.h
/usr/local/include/psa/crypto_adjust_config_dependencies.h
/usr/local/include/psa/crypto_adjust_config_key_pair_types.h
/usr/local/include/psa/crypto_adjust_config_synonyms.h
/usr/local/include/psa/crypto_builtin_composites.h
@@ -179,14 +180,14 @@
/usr/local/lib/libmbedcrypto.a
/usr/local/lib/libmbedcrypto.so
/usr/local/lib/libmbedcrypto.so.16
/usr/local/lib/libmbedcrypto.so.3.6.0
/usr/local/lib/libmbedcrypto.so.3.6.2
/usr/local/lib/libmbedtls.a
/usr/local/lib/libmbedtls.so
/usr/local/lib/libmbedtls.so.21
/usr/local/lib/libmbedtls.so.3.6.0
/usr/local/lib/libmbedtls.so.3.6.2
/usr/local/lib/libmbedx509.a
/usr/local/lib/libmbedx509.so
/usr/local/lib/libmbedx509.so.3.6.0
/usr/local/lib/libmbedx509.so.3.6.2
/usr/local/lib/libmbedx509.so.7
/usr/local/lib/libp256m.a
/usr/local/lib/pkgconfig/mbedcrypto.pc

View File

@@ -152,6 +152,7 @@
/usr/local/include/psa/build_info.h
/usr/local/include/psa/crypto.h
/usr/local/include/psa/crypto_adjust_auto_enabled.h
/usr/local/include/psa/crypto_adjust_config_dependencies.h
/usr/local/include/psa/crypto_adjust_config_key_pair_types.h
/usr/local/include/psa/crypto_adjust_config_synonyms.h
/usr/local/include/psa/crypto_builtin_composites.h
@@ -179,14 +180,14 @@
/usr/local/lib64/libmbedcrypto.a
/usr/local/lib64/libmbedcrypto.so
/usr/local/lib64/libmbedcrypto.so.16
/usr/local/lib64/libmbedcrypto.so.3.6.0
/usr/local/lib64/libmbedcrypto.so.3.6.2
/usr/local/lib64/libmbedtls.a
/usr/local/lib64/libmbedtls.so
/usr/local/lib64/libmbedtls.so.21
/usr/local/lib64/libmbedtls.so.3.6.0
/usr/local/lib64/libmbedtls.so.3.6.2
/usr/local/lib64/libmbedx509.a
/usr/local/lib64/libmbedx509.so
/usr/local/lib64/libmbedx509.so.3.6.0
/usr/local/lib64/libmbedx509.so.3.6.2
/usr/local/lib64/libmbedx509.so.7
/usr/local/lib64/libp256m.a
/usr/local/lib64/pkgconfig/mbedcrypto.pc

View File

@@ -3,7 +3,7 @@ require 'buildsystems/cmake'
class Libmbedtls < CMake
description 'An open source, portable, easy to use, readable and flexible SSL library'
homepage 'https://www.trustedfirmware.org/projects/mbed-tls/'
version '3.6.0'
version '3.6.2'
license 'Apache-2.0'
compatibility 'all'
source_url 'https://github.com/ARMmbed/mbedtls.git'
@@ -11,10 +11,10 @@ class Libmbedtls < CMake
binary_compression 'tar.zst'
binary_sha256({
aarch64: 'fb5f733356acdd57769af17d70d3369b2deb38ce130360ccbcd8a065ff61103e',
armv7l: 'fb5f733356acdd57769af17d70d3369b2deb38ce130360ccbcd8a065ff61103e',
i686: '316dddb6af3d89939333d256d97a256ce31947cda68ee55035b89901d9d49839',
x86_64: '4891dfd90df0c29e0646e27aceba87b8932e4b4a817ec995a928c82bcca5d7c9'
aarch64: 'f4f94256f39201657f86105891b4be02fa87efb92f1c25b36867a4057fe4462c',
armv7l: 'f4f94256f39201657f86105891b4be02fa87efb92f1c25b36867a4057fe4462c',
i686: 'ca6a29c8f2891016908c259751a504019cab5d52c01a95562b63da03617da72c',
x86_64: '24aaf1c149f5f24d317f09a46d466c595e180efe1877b7e0d4e1dc30811f5722'
})
depends_on 'glibc' # R